Pakistan cricket team used 8 bowlers for the first time in a T20 match and won a new record.
The last match of the 5-match T20 series between Pakistan and New Zealand was played at Gaddafi Stadium Lahore yesterday. Pakistan won the last match by 9 runs to level the series 2-2.
The 5-match series between Pakistan and New Zealand is tied at 2-2
During the second innings of the T20 match, Pakistan captain Babar Azam made the best use of his bowlers. Babar Azam bowled 8 of his bowlers to defeat New Zealand in the last T20I.
For Pakistan, Shaheen Shah Afridi, Mohammad Amir and Abbas Afridi handled the pace attack while Osama Mir, Iftikhar Ahmed, Shadab Khan and Imad Wasim troubled the batsmen in the spin department.
Babar Azam has won another honor in T20
Captain Babar Azam also bowled opening batsman Saeem Ayub in the last T20 match. Saeem Ayub bowled 20 runs in 2 overs with an economy of 10.
It should be noted that 9 bowlers have been used the most in a match so far in the history of T20 International. This record is held by the cricket team of New Guinea, Denmark, South Korea and Saudi Arabia.
